GUNTUR: Tenali police arrested four persons in connection with the murder of a man. Disclosing this to newsmen on Sunday, Two Town CI B Kalyan said Dasaboina Gopi (35) of Kantamraju Konduru married Sujatha long ago.    Having learnt that she developed extramarital relationship with some others, he warned her.

Later, he shifted his family to Vetapalem. But Sujatha continued her illicit affairs. Vexed with her attitude, Gopi threatened to gift his farm land to his sisters if she failed to stop the illegal affairs. The worried Sujatha hatched a conspiracy to murder her husband Gopi with the help of Sk Arif of Kolakaluru.

In pursuance of the plan, she visited Tenali along with her husband on September 13 where they met Arif and his friends K Jayaraj and MS Sankar. The trio took Gopi to Kolakaluru where they consumed liquor. Arif offered liquor mixed with sedatives to Gopi.

While he was in an inebriated state, the trio threw Gopi into a canal. Sujatha lodged complaint with Tsunduru police on September 15 stating that her husband went missing. The police found the body of Gopi in the canal at Telagayapalem. Later, it was revealed that Sujatha eliminated her husband.
